K-wickest to 1,500: Sale strikes mark

Ace Chris Sale hit an impressive milestone in the second inning of the Red Sox’s 3-0 win vs. the Blue Jays on Tuesday night, becoming the fastest pitcher in Major League history to reach 1,500 strikeouts.

Once again, the Cleveland Indians are minus a significant piece. Second baseman Jason Kipnis is likely to miss opening day because of a sore right shoulder, an injury that could cause the AL champions to re-shape their infield for the start of this season. Kipnis has been slowed by inflammation in his shoulder throughout training camp and the Indians are going to shut him down for two weeks to see how it responds.

Leonys Martin’s 6th-inning homer was Cleveland’s first hit, and Corey Kluber didn’t need more help, throwing a dominant complete-game shutout. The Tribe tacked on anyway after breaking through against Angels starter Felix Pena, who allowed two runs in 5 1/3 innings after a tough outing last time. But Kluber, the two-time Cy Young Award winner, was back at his best after subpar starts in his past two turns at home, finishing off a “Maddux” in 98 pitches, with seven strikeouts.
